The 3D printing filament market has experienced significant growth in recent years, driven by the increasing adoption of 3D printing technology across various industries. Filaments are essential materials used in the additive manufacturing process to create three-dimensional objects layer by layer. They come in different types, including thermoplastics, metals, ceramics, and composites, each with specific properties to suit different printing needs.
One of the primary factors driving the growth of the 3D Printing Filament Market Size is the expanding application areas of 3D printing technology. Industries such as aerospace, automotive, healthcare, consumer goods, and education are increasingly utilizing 3D printing for prototyping, production, and customization. This increased adoption has led to a growing demand for high-quality filaments with diverse material properties to meet the specific requirements of different applications.
Another significant driver of market growth is the continuous innovation in filament materials and manufacturing processes. Manufacturers are constantly developing new filament formulations with enhanced properties such as strength, durability, flexibility, and heat resistance to cater to the evolving needs of end-users. For example, advanced materials like carbon fiber-reinforced filaments offer superior strength and stiffness, making them ideal for applications requiring structural integrity.
Additionally, the availability of a wide range of filament types and colors has fueled the growth of the consumer market for 3D printing filaments. Hobbyists, artists, and DIY enthusiasts are increasingly using 3D printers to create custom-designed objects for personal use or as part of small-scale businesses. The availability of affordable desktop 3D printers and a variety of filament options has democratized the technology, making it accessible to a broader audience.
Moreover, the growing emphasis on sustainability and environmental consciousness has led to the development of eco-friendly filaments made from biodegradable or recycled materials. These filaments offer a more sustainable alternative to traditional plastics and contribute to reducing the environmental impact of 3D printing. As sustainability becomes a key focus for businesses and consumers alike, the demand for eco-friendly filaments is expected to continue rising.
However, despite the promising growth prospects, the 3D Printing Filament Market Trends faces several challenges. One of the primary challenges is the volatility in raw material prices, particularly for petroleum-based thermoplastics. Fluctuations in oil prices can significantly impact the cost of filament production, leading to price fluctuations for end-users. Manufacturers must navigate these price fluctuations and optimize their supply chains to ensure cost-effectiveness and competitiveness in the market.
Furthermore, quality control and consistency are critical factors in the 3D printing filament market. Variations in filament diameter, moisture content, and other properties can affect print quality and result in defects or failures. To address this issue, manufacturers invest in quality control measures and testing processes to ensure that their filaments meet stringent quality standards. Additionally, educating end-users about proper storage and handling procedures can help minimize the risk of print failures due to filament-related issues.

The artificial leather market is a large and growing market that is expected to reach a value of $54.11 billion by 2032. The market is driven by the increasing demand for sustainable and vegan alternatives to natural leather, the growing popularity of synthetic leather in the automotive and furniture industries, and the development of new technologies that make artificial leather more durable and realistic.
Artificial leather is a material that is made from synthetic fibers, such as polyurethane (PU) or polyvinyl chloride (PVC). It is often used as a substitute for natural leather because it is less expensive, more durable, and easier to care for. Artificial leather can also be made to look and feel like natural leather, making it a popular choice for a variety of applications.
The global artificial leather market is segmented by product type, application, and region. The product type segment is dominated by PU leather, which accounts for the largest share of the market. PU leather is a popular choice because it is relatively inexpensive, durable, and easy to care for. PVC leather is another major product type, and it is used in a variety of applications, such as footwear and furniture.
The application segment is divided into footwear, furniture, automotive, clothing, and others. Footwear is the largest application segment for artificial leather, and it is expected to continue to grow in the coming years. The automotive segment is also a major market for artificial leather, and it is expected to grow due to the increasing demand for sustainable and vegan curable materials in the automotive industry.
The regional segment is divided into North America, Europe, Asia Pacific, Latin America, and Middle East & Africa. Asia Pacific is the largest market for artificial leather, and it is expected to continue to grow in the coming years due to the growing demand for synthetic leather in the region.

Ocean bound plastics refer to plastic waste that has the potential to enter the ocean and contribute to marine pollution. This article aims to provide an overview of the ocean bound plastics market size, its current status, and growth potential. It highlights the importance of addressing this issue and the efforts being made to mitigate plastic pollution in our oceans.
Current Status of the Ocean Bound Plastics Market:
The Ocean Bound Plastics Market has gained significant attention in recent years due to the alarming levels of plastic pollution in our oceans. The scale of the problem is enormous, with an estimated 8 million metric tons of plastic entering the oceans every year. This plastic waste originates from various sources, including coastal communities, rivers, inadequate waste management systems, and improper disposal practices.
Market Size and Growth Potential:
The market size for ocean bound plastics is difficult to quantify accurately due to the complexity of the issue and the lack of a standardized approach to measurement. However, several studies and initiatives have provided insights into the potential market size and the economic opportunities associated with addressing ocean plastic pollution.
Recycling and Waste Management: One significant segment of the ocean bound plastics market revolves around recycling and waste management. There is a growing demand for effective recycling technologies and infrastructure that can efficiently process and transform plastic waste into valuable resources. This sector presents opportunities for businesses involved in Medical plastic collection, sorting, and recycling.
Innovative Solutions and Technologies: Another area of growth potential lies in the development of innovative solutions and technologies that can prevent plastic waste from entering the oceans. These include initiatives such as river and coastal clean-up programs, advanced waste collection systems, and technologies that facilitate the responsible disposal and recycling of plastics.
Circular Economy Initiatives: The concept of a circular economy, where plastics are designed, used, and managed in a way that minimizes waste generation and maximizes their lifespan, has gained traction. This approach promotes recycling, reuse, and responsible consumption practices, presenting opportunities for businesses to develop sustainable products and implement circular economy models.

The crushers market is a key segment within the global machinery and equipment industry, playing a crucial role in various sectors such as mining, construction, and recycling. Crushers are devices designed to reduce the size of large rocks, stones, or other materials into smaller particles for easier handling, transportation, and processing. They are widely used in applications ranging from quarrying and demolition to road construction and aggregate production.
One of the primary drivers of the Crushers Market Share is the growth in construction and mining activities worldwide. As urbanization continues to accelerate and infrastructure projects multiply, the demand for aggregates and materials processed by crushers is expected to rise. Moreover, the increasing emphasis on sustainable practices and environmental regulations is driving the adoption of crushers that are more energy-efficient and produce less noise and dust emissions.
In recent years, technological advancements have been a significant trend in the crushers market. Manufacturers are continuously innovating to improve the performance, efficiency, and reliability of their products. This includes the development of advanced control systems, automation features, and predictive maintenance capabilities to enhance the operational efficiency of crushers and reduce downtime.
Another emerging trend in the Crushers Market Trends is the growing demand for mobile crushers and screeners. Mobile crushers offer greater flexibility and mobility, allowing operators to easily transport them to different job sites and reduce the need for stationary crushing plants. This trend is particularly evident in the construction sector, where contractors require mobile crushers to efficiently process materials on-site.
Furthermore, the adoption of hybrid and electric crushers is gaining traction as industries seek to reduce their carbon footprint and comply with stricter emissions standards. Hybrid crushers combine diesel engines with electric motors or battery packs to improve fuel efficiency and reduce emissions, while electric crushers operate solely on electricity, eliminating exhaust emissions altogether.
The COVID-19 pandemic had a mixed impact on the crushers market. While the global economic slowdown and disruptions in supply chains initially led to a decline in demand for crushers, the gradual recovery in construction and mining activities in the post-pandemic period has spurred market growth. Additionally, the pandemic has underscored the importance of automation and remote monitoring solutions in the crushers industry, driving greater adoption of digital technologies.

Flexible packaging refers to packaging materials made from flexible or easily yielding materials such as plastic, paper, aluminum foil, or a combination of these materials. These materials are used to create pouches, bags, wraps, and other forms of packaging that can be easily manipulated and adapted to the shape of the product being packaged. The flexible packaging market has experienced significant growth in recent years due to its versatility, convenience, and sustainability.
In 2021, the market for flexible packaging was estimated to be worth USD 150.04 billion. According to projections, the flexible packaging market would expand at a compound annual growth rate (CAGR) of 4.9% from USD 157.40 billion in 2022 to USD 230.78 billion by 2030.
One of the key drivers of the Flexible Packaging Market Size is its ability to provide lightweight and convenient packaging solutions. Flexible packaging materials are often much lighter than traditional rigid packaging materials such as glass or metal, which can reduce transportation costs and environmental impact. Additionally, flexible packaging can be easily resealed, allowing consumers to use only the amount of product they need and preserve the rest for later use. This helps to reduce food waste and extend the shelf life of perishable products.
Another factor driving the growth of the Flexible Packaging Market Analysis is its ability to offer customizable packaging solutions. Manufacturers can easily print vibrant graphics and branding onto flexible packaging materials, allowing them to create eye-catching packaging designs that stand out on store shelves. Additionally, flexible packaging can be tailored to fit a wide range of product shapes and sizes, making it ideal for packaging everything from snacks and beverages to household goods and personal care products.
In addition to its versatility and convenience, flexible packaging is also increasingly being recognized for its sustainability benefits. Many flexible packaging materials are recyclable, and advancements in recycling technology are making it easier to recover and recycle these materials. Additionally, flexible packaging often requires less energy and resources to produce than traditional rigid packaging materials, further reducing its environmental impact. As consumers become more environmentally conscious, there is growing demand for sustainable packaging solutions, driving the adoption of flexible packaging across various industries.
The food and beverage industry is one of the largest consumers of flexible packaging, accounting for a significant portion of the market's growth. Flexible packaging is widely used to package snacks, confectionery, pet food, and beverages due to its ability to preserve freshness and extend shelf life. In addition to its functional benefits, flexible packaging also offers brands opportunities for innovation and differentiation, allowing them to introduce new product formats and packaging designs to attract consumers.
The pharmaceutical and healthcare industries are also significant contributors to the Flexible Packaging Market Share . Flexible packaging materials such as blister packs, sachets, and pouches are commonly used to package pharmaceuticals, medical devices, and healthcare products. These materials offer benefits such as tamper-evident seals, moisture barriers, and UV protection, helping to ensure the safety and efficacy of the products they contain.
The growth of the e-commerce industry is also driving demand for flexible packaging solutions. As more consumers shop online, there is a growing need for packaging materials that can protect products during shipping and handling. Flexible packaging materials such as bubble mailers, poly mailers, and protective wraps are commonly used to package items for e-commerce delivery, offering lightweight and cost-effective solutions for businesses.

The phosphate market is a crucial component of the global economy, as phosphate is an essential nutrient for plant growth and a key ingredient in various industries. Phosphate is primarily used as a fertilizer in agriculture to enhance crop yields and improve soil fertility. It is also utilized in the production of animal feed, food additives, and industrial chemicals. With the world's population growing and arable land becoming increasingly scarce, the demand for phosphate continues to rise, making it a significant market with implications for food security and economic development.
The phosphate market is relatively consolidated with major players such as OCP Group (Morocco), The Mosaic Company (US), EuroChem Group (Switzerland), Nutrien Ltd (Canada), Jordan Phosphate Mines Co . (Jordan), ICL Group Ltd (Israel), PhosAgro (Russia), Ma’aden-Saudi Arabian Mining Company (Saudi Arabia), Yara International ASA (Norway), Innophos Holdings, Inc. (US), Yunnan Phosphate Haikou Co., Ltd. (YPH) (China). These companies are focusing on sustainable mining practices and efficient processing technologies to mitigate environmental impact.
In recent years, there have been fluctuations in the Phosphate Market Size due to various factors such as changes in agricultural practices, shifts in consumer preferences, and geopolitical tensions. For example, the adoption of sustainable farming practices and the development of alternative fertilizers have led to some changes in the demand for phosphate products. Additionally, concerns about environmental sustainability and the depletion of phosphate reserves have prompted efforts to improve phosphate recycling and develop more efficient use of phosphorus resources.
One of the key challenges facing the phosphate market is the finite nature of phosphate reserves. Phosphate rock deposits are non-renewable resources, and current estimates suggest that global reserves could be depleted within the next few decades if consumption continues at current rates. This has led to calls for greater investment in phosphate recycling and research into alternative sources of phosphorus, such as phosphate recovery from wastewater and agricultural by-products.
Another challenge for the Phosphate Market Share is the environmental impact of phosphate mining and fertilizer use. Phosphate mining can have adverse effects on local ecosystems, including habitat destruction, water pollution, and soil degradation. Additionally, the excessive use of phosphate fertilizers can contribute to water pollution and eutrophication, leading to harmful algal blooms and other ecological problems. As a result, there is growing pressure on the phosphate industry to adopt more sustainable practices and develop environmentally friendly alternatives.
Despite these challenges, the Phosphate Market Trends remains resilient and continues to expand as global demand for food and agricultural products grows. In addition to traditional uses in agriculture, phosphate is also finding new applications in industries such as pharmaceuticals, detergents, and flame retardants. As technological advancements and environmental concerns drive innovation in the phosphate industry, it is likely to remain a critical component of the global economy for the foreseeable future.

Fluorspar, also known as fluorite, is a crucial mineral employed in numerous industrial applications, and it has been drawing global attention in recent years. This report will shed light on the fluorspar market and the forces shaping its dynamics as of 2023.
Primarily used as a flux in smelting processes and in the production of hydrofluoric acid, fluorspar plays a vital role in a plethora of industries, including steel, aluminum, chemical, and cement. The versatility of fluorspar, coupled with its growing applications, has been instrumental in driving the market's growth.
In 2023, the fluorspar market was estimated to be worth USD 2.3 billion. According to projections, the fluorspar sector would expand at a compound annual growth rate (CAGR) of 5.10% from USD 2.42 billion in 2024 to USD 3.4 billion by 2032.
The steel industry is the primary consumer of fluorspar, utilizing it as a flux to lower the melting point of raw materials in steel production, thus reducing energy consumption. As the world continues to urbanize and develop, the demand for steel processing in construction, transportation, and infrastructure projects is increasing, indirectly driving the fluorspar market.
Additionally, fluorspar's role in the production of aluminum and hydrofluoric acid makes it indispensable for several other sectors. The thriving automobile and aerospace industries have led to a surge in aluminum demand, subsequently propelling the fluorspar market. Furthermore, hydrofluoric acid, derived from fluorspar, is crucial in the production of refrigerants, propellants, and pharmaceuticals, further diversifying the fluorspar market base.
In the cement industry, fluorspar is used to speed up the calcination process, contributing to the efficient production of cement. The growing construction activities across the globe are expected to continue boosting the fluorspar market.
Geographically, the Asia-Pacific region, particularly China, is a key player in the global fluorspar market. With a rapidly growing industrial sector, China's demand for steel, aluminum pigments , and cement is exceptionally high, contributing significantly to the global demand for fluorspar. The nation is also the leading fluorspar producer, dominating the supply side of the market.
However, the fluorspar market is not devoid of challenges. Environmental concerns linked with fluorspar mining and the harmful effects of fluorine gases on human health can hinder the market growth. Regulations imposed by environmental agencies to control fluorine gas emissions are expected to increase the operational costs for fluorspar miners and processors, possibly affecting the market dynamics.
Moreover, the volatility of the mining industry and uncertainties in global trade can disrupt the fluorspar supply chain. However, initiatives to recycle fluorspar and technological advancements to mitigate environmental impacts offer potential solutions.

In recent years, the PET bottle recycling market has witnessed remarkable growth, driven by increasing environmental awareness, stringent regulations, and growing demand for sustainable packaging solutions. PET (Polyethylene Terephthalate) is one of the most commonly used materials for beverage packaging due to its lightweight, durability, and versatility. However, the disposal of PET bottles poses significant environmental challenges, including pollution of landfills, waterways, and oceans. The recycling of PET bottles has emerged as a crucial solution to mitigate these challenges while fostering a circular economy.
In 2023, the PET bottle recycling market was estimated to be worth USD 4.8 billion. Over the forecast period (2024 - 2032), the PET bottle recycling industry is expected to increase at a compound annual growth rate (CAGR) of 5.10%, from USD 5.1 billion in 2024 to USD 7.6 billion by 2032.
Market Dynamics
The global PET Bottle Recycling Market Size has experienced substantial expansion, propelled by various factors. One of the primary drivers is the escalating concern over environmental pollution caused by single-use plastics. Governments, environmental organizations, and consumers are increasingly advocating for sustainable practices, prompting manufacturers to adopt recycled PET (rPET) as a key component in their packaging solutions.
Moreover, regulatory initiatives mandating the use of recycled materials in packaging and setting recycling targets have further bolstered market growth. Countries worldwide are implementing extended producer responsibility (EPR) schemes and deposit return systems (DRS) to incentivize recycling and reduce plastic waste.

Technological Advancements
Advancements in recycling technologies have significantly enhanced the efficiency and quality of PET bottle recycling processes. Innovations such as bottle-to-bottle recycling systems enable the conversion of post-consumer PET bottles into food-grade rPET, suitable for packaging beverages and other consumer products. These technologies ensure that recycled PET maintains the same level of purity and performance as virgin PET, thereby facilitating its widespread adoption by manufacturers.
Furthermore, developments in sorting, washing, and decontamination processes have addressed concerns regarding the hygiene and safety of recycled PET, making it a viable alternative to virgin plastic for food and beverage packaging.
Market Opportunities
The PET Bottle Recycling Market Trends presents lucrative opportunities for stakeholders across the value chain. Recycling companies are expanding their operations and investing in infrastructure to meet the growing demand for rPET. Additionally, collaborations between recyclers, brand owners, and retailers are fostering innovation and driving the development of sustainable packaging solutions.
Furthermore, consumer preferences are shifting towards eco-friendly products, creating a demand pull for recycled PET packaging. Companies that embrace sustainability and incorporate recycled materials into their packaging portfolios stand to gain a competitive advantage in the market.
Challenges and Future Outlook
Despite its significant growth prospects, the PET Bottle Recycling Market Analysis faces several challenges. Collection and sorting infrastructure vary significantly across regions, leading to inefficiencies in the recycling supply chain. Additionally, the low market price of virgin PET and fluctuations in the cost of recycled materials pose economic challenges for recyclers.
However, advancements in waste management infrastructure, coupled with increased consumer awareness and regulatory support, are expected to drive the continued growth of the PET bottle recycling market. Moreover, innovations in chemical recycling technologies hold promise for overcoming the limitations of mechanical recycling and expanding the scope of recycled PET applications.
